Transaction 71cb04fe29aab23114d7a3a4bfe178eebdc6ed1ede25f7b373a8a996d2eb2c1e
1 Input
1 Output
-
71cb04fe29aab23114d7a3a4bfe178eebdc6ed1ede25f7b373a8a996d2eb2c1e:0
- value
- 269086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8ce94344eee07a758a08e2f14f7d874da098a1 OP_EQUAL
- address
- 3MoBPRitbry72ABQEBJ1WT8r4mKzfGDdYV